Unhappy MAF Sensor = Stalling Ranger?

Hello again to all @ FTE,

Have (Hopefully Had) Ranger stalling problem while running about town.

Found connection tube from Filter Intake Box to Intake Plenum/Manifold partally disconnected thus allowing outside air to also enter and not all through the MAF as it should and was wondering if this (Hopefully) was my problem.

Also very interesting was as the motor was bogging down and I pumped the gas pedal before I would get a response and she would get up + go but today I had to put her into neutral, turn the ignition key to the off position then back to ignition position and pop the clutch to restart her.

It does/did? seem like a fuel delivery or ignition/electrical problem too but I ruled them out when I found the disconnection listed above.

And after I reconnected her together I reluctantly took her out for a drive around town and all seems ok...for now...ya' know when something like this happens ya' stop +wonder if the problem is really resolved.

And, I know, "Pull The Codes" if problem persists!

Thanx in advance to all in resolution herein,

w/ Ranger 90' 2.3 EFI

Smile MAF.... Problem Diagnosed!

Hi CMOS,

THANK YOU MUCH FOR ASKING...I LOVE BEING ANALYTICAL!!

Because of my Ranger's MAF not having full outside airflow going through it (because of the partially disconnected hose that comes from the air cleaner; where the MAF is located, on my 90' 2.3 EFI, to the TB>intake plenum) caused a lean signal condition to the PCM and as the engine got hotter this is what actully caused her to completely stall several times because of insufficent air flow through the MAF.

For that high idle you might want to pull off the vaccum line to the fuel pressure regulator and see if there is any gas coming out of it.

Right, the pressure is not being regulated correctly depending on how bad it is, and that vacuum tube leads right back to the intake manifold. So your giving the engine gas through the fuel injectors, and its being sucked in through that vacuum tube.
